@charset "utf-8";
body {
	background-color: #ffffff;
}


.menu {
	border-bottom:5px #054B78 solid;
}

.menu td{
	border-right:1px #E6F2FF solid;
}

.menu a{
	font-size:18px;
	color:#FFF;
	padding-left:61px;
	padding-right:61px;
	padding-top:12px;
	padding-bottom:13px;
}

.menu a:hover{
	font-size:18px;
	color:#FFF;
	font-weight:bold;
	background-color:#054B78;
	padding-left:61px;
	padding-right:61px;
	padding-top:12px;
	padding-bottom:13px;
}


#apDiv1 {
	position: absolute;
	width: 92px;
	height: 18px;
	z-index: 999;
}
#apDiv2 {
	position: absolute;
	width: 1166px;
	height: 310px;
	z-index: 1;
	background-color: #FFFFFF;
	top: 246px;
	border: 2px #054B78 solid;
	padding: 5px;
	visibility: hidden;
}
#apDiv3 {
	position: absolute;
	width: 1166px;
	height: 310px;
	z-index: 1;
	background-color: #FFFFFF;
	top: 246px;
	border: 2px #054B78 solid;
	padding: 5px;
	visibility: hidden;
}
#apDiv4 {
	position: absolute;
	width: 1166px;
	height: 310px;
	z-index: 1;
	background-color: #FFFFFF;
	top: 246px;
	border: 2px #054B78 solid;
	padding: 5px;
	visibility: hidden;
}
#apDiv5 {
	position: absolute;
	width: 1166px;
	height: 310px;
	z-index: 1;
	background-color: #FFFFFF;
	top: 246px;
	border: 2px #054B78 solid;
	padding: 5px;
	visibility: hidden;
}
#apDiv6 {
	position: absolute;
	width: 1166px;
	height: 310px;
	z-index: 1;
	background-color: #FFFFFF;
	top: 246px;
	border: 2px #054B78 solid;
	padding: 5px;
	visibility: hidden;
}
#apDiv7 {
	position: absolute;
	width: 1166px;
	height: 310px;
	z-index: 1;
	background-color: #FFFFFF;
	top: 246px;
	border: 2px #054B78 solid;
	padding: 5px;
	visibility: hidden;
}



.news {
	border-top:5px #054B78 solid;
	}
	
.box-tit {
	height:38px;
	line-height:38px;
	border-bottom:1px #CCCCCC solid;
	background:url(../images/dot_news.png) no-repeat 10px 10px;
	padding-left:30px;
	padding-top:8px;
	}
	
.box-tit li {
	float:left;
	width:100px;
	height:30px;
	line-height:30px;
	text-align:center;
	font-size:18px;
	color:#8F8F8F;
	border-right:1px #CCCCCC solid;
	}
.box-tit .on {
	color:#054B78;
	font-weight:bold;
	}

.box-con {
	height:260px;
	}


.link-jg {
	text-align:center;
	float:left;
	width:96px;
	height:25px;
	line-height:25px;
	margin-bottom:3px;
	margin-right:5px;
	background-color:#F0FFF0;
	
	border:#CCC 1px solid;

	
	}

.link-tit{
	 background-color:#3F88ED; 
	 height:25px;
	 line-height:25px; 
	 width:115px; 
	 color:#FFF; 
	 font-size:14px;
	 margin-left:40px;
	 text-align:center;
	 margin-top:10px;
	 }
.link-list {
	 height:60px;
	 border-top:3px #3F88ED solid;
	 text-align:center;
}

.bottom {
	background-color:#666666;
	height:100px;
	}a {
	color: #333;
	text-decoration: none;
}
a:hover {
	color: #0058B0;
	text-decoration: underline;
}

.good h1 { font-size:30px; }
.good h2 { font-size:12px; color:#999; }

.good li {
	background:url(../images/dot01.png) no-repeat 0 0 ; 
	padding-left:30px;
	font-size:18px;
	}
	
.plist1 {
	height: 33px;
	line-height: 33px;
	background: url(../images/list-bg.png);
	border: #F6F6F6 1px solid;
	margin-bottom: 5px;
	font-weight: bold;
	color: #333;
}

.plist2 {
	height:25px;
	line-height:25px;
	margin-bottom:5px;

	list-style:none;
	padding-left:20px;
	text-align:left;
}

.morelink2 {color:#06F}


.more_p {
	width:220px; 
	height:40px; 
	text-align:center;
	margin: 0 auto;
	border:2px #B9B9B9 solid;
	background-color:#E8E8E8;
	line-height:40px;
	font-size:18px;
	font-weight:bold;
	}
	
.more_p:hover {
	width:220px; 
	height:40px; 
	text-align:center;
	margin: 0 auto;
	background-color:#0CF;
	border:2px #0CF solid;
	line-height:40px;
	font-size:20px;
	font-weight:bold;
	color:#FFF;
	}
.pp2{
	font-size:16px;
	font-weight:bold;
	color:#666;
	}
a.tt1{
	font-size:16px;
	color:#FFF;
	font-weight:bold;}
a.tt1:hover{
	font-size:18px;
	color:#FFF;
	font-weight:bold;}
